Mental Health Therapist, LCSW, LPCC, LMFT – Telehealth
Daybreak HealthLicensed Therapist providing teletherapy to youth ages 11–24 in California. Work remotely with a focus on mental health care and support for students.

About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Provide evidence-based individual teletherapy to students ages 11–24 with mild-to-moderate mental health conditions
- Build trusted relationships with youth and families
- Provide psychoeducation to parents/caregivers
- Minimum caseload: Varies by employment type. W-2 full-time requires at least 25 time slots with a minimum of 17 completed sessions per week. 1099 contractors have a minimum of 5 sessions per week.
- Employment Type: Choose between W-2 with full benefits OR 1099 Independent Contractor
Requirements
What you’ll need- Licensed Professional with LCSW, LPCC, or LMFT credentials in the State of California
- Experience diagnosing, treatment planning, and working with youth and families in clinical or school settings
- Strong telehealth skills and reliable high-speed Internet connection
- Commitment to culturally responsive care and equity
Benefits
Comp & perks- Competitive Compensation: W-2: $55,000–$115,000 annual (bi-weekly standardized payment)
- Competitive Compensation: 1099: $70–$85 per session (plus no-show & late-cancel pay)
- Flexible Schedule: Set your hours Monday–Friday (3-8 PM) with optional weekends (9am-5pm)
- W2 Caseload Commitment: W-2 clinicians carry a caseload of 25 weekly slots (Monday-Friday 3pm-8pm PST), with a target of 17 completed sessions per week averaged across the month. Daybreak provides consistent referrals and scheduling assistance to help you reach this target consistently.
- Full Benefits (W-2): Medical, dental, vision, PTO, paid holidays, CEUs, supervisor support
- Contract Perks (1099): Low weekly caseload minimum (5 sessions), CEUs, bilingual pay, cross-license bonuses in states we are active in
- Administrative support: We provide consistent referrals, billing, credentialing, and scheduling so you can focus on care.
- Fully Remote Role: Work from anywhere in the US with a reliable Internet connection
- Professional Development: CE credits, malpractice insurance, and ongoing training opportunities
- Supportive Clinical Community: Peer consultation, collaborative network, and team discussions
